CVT SYSTEM


  1. OUTLINE


    1. A K311 Continuously Variable Transmission (CVT) is used on the models with the 2ZR-FAE engine.

    2. A 7-speed sport sequential shiftmatic system is used.

    3. A shift paddle switch (transmission shift switch assembly) is provided.

    4. A gate type shift lever is used.

  2. SPECIFICATION

    CVT Assembly
    Shift Mechanism Type Pulley and Steel Belt
    Forward/Reverse Switching Mechanism Double Pinion Type Planetary Gear
    Pulley Ratio Forward 2.386 to 0.411
    Reverse 2.505 to 1.680
    Final Gear Ratio 5.698
    Fluid Capacity 7.6 Liters (8.0 US qts, 6.7 Imp. qts)
    Fluid Type Toyota Genuine CVT Fluid FE
    Weight (Reference) 68.7 kg (151.1 lb)
    Friction Discs and Gears
    Planetary Gear No. of Sun Gear Teeth 40
    No. of No. 1 Pinion Gear Teeth 18
    No. of No. 2 Pinion Gear Teeth 17
    No. of Ring Gear Teeth 82
    Reduction Gear Drive Gears 25
    Driven Gears 37
    Forward Clutch No. of Discs 3
    Reverse Brake No. of Discs 3
    Torque Converter Clutch Assembly
    Torque Converter Clutch Type 3-element, 1-step, 2-phase
    Stall Torque Ratio 1.75
